Miscanthus x giganteus ~ Giant Maiden Grass Size:18-CT FLAT (2) Photo by Ahmad FuadGiant Maiden Grass is a massive upright clumping ornamental grass with gracefully arched blades that turns burnt orange in fall and fades to tan in winter. The silvery tassel like plumes bloom in late summer to fall. Best color in full sun and moist well drained soil. Giant Maiden Grass is sterile. Type: Orn.
